Key Responsibilities Collaborate in development activities, including business requirement analysis and impact assessments. Take ownership of features and user stories assigned in each sprint cycle. Design technical solutions, including data models, sequence diagrams, and other architectural components. Work closely with Business Analysts and Product Owners to refine and clarify technical requirements. Adhere to coding standards and best practices; ensure Jira and backlog hygiene is maintained. Perform integration testing and ensure safe and stable code check-ins. Maintain a strong understanding of the system architecture, its components, and key features. Essential Qualifications & Skills Bachelor’s or Master’s degree in Computer Science, Engineering, or a related field (B.Tech/M.Tech/BE/MCA). Minimum 5 years of experience in software development. Hands-on expertise in Spring Framework, Spring Boot, and JavaScript frameworks. Strong understanding of Java/JEE internals, Object-Oriented Programming (OOP), and design patterns. Proficiency in SQL, JPA2, Hibernate, Entity Framework (EF), and unit testing methodologies. Preferred Skills: Experience with Corda R3, Blockchain technologies, Camunda BPM, and React JS frontend development.
We, in ChainThat, are looking for a talented and experienced AI Developer to design and implement advanced AI-driven solutions for our organization. The ideal candidate will have a strong background in Python, REST APIs, PostgreSQL, and vector databases, with hands-on experience in building Generative AI models. A background in the insurance domain is a bonus but not mandatory. We are a UK and India based fast growing technology firm focused on developing software products aimed at insurance and reinsurance organizations. We use latest cutting-edge enterprise technologies to innovate and build suite of products across the insurance lifecycle – all utilizing enterprise best practices in terms of product design and development. Job Key Responsibilities: AI Solution Development: Develop, train, and deploy AI and Generative AI models to address business challenges. Vector Database Implementation: Work with vector databases (e.g., Pinecone, Weaviate, Milvus) to support semantic search and similarity-based applications. API Development: Design, implement, and maintain REST APIs for AI solution integration into existing systems. Data Engineering: Build and optimize data pipelines, including PostgreSQL schemas, queries, and database performance tuning. Model Optimization: Fine-tune and optimize machine learning models for performance, scalability, and efficiency. Collaboration: Partner with cross-functional teams to understand requirements, prototype solutions, and deliver high-impact AI capabilities. Documentation: Write clean, maintainable code and document AI workflows, models, and systems. Insurance Expertise (Preferred): Collaborate on use cases for risk analysis, claims automation, and underwriting if applicable to the role. Technology Skills Minimum 5 years of experience in Python and related AI/ML libraries (e.g., TensorFlow, PyTorch, Hugging Face). Proven experience with Generative AI models (e.g., GPT, Gemini, Claude) and their deployment. Hands-on experience with vector databases (e.g., Pinecone, Weaviate). Proficiency in building and integrating REST APIs . Solid understanding of PostgreSQL or similar relational databases, including query optimization and schema design. Experience with cloud platforms (e.g., AWS, Azure, GCP) for deploying AI solutions. Strong problem-solving skills and the ability to work on complex AI projects. Familiarity with MLOps practices for CI/CD pipelines in AI model deployment. Understanding of ethical AI practices and data privacy regulations. Our promise to you : At ChainThat, we are an equal opportunity employer. We foster an inclusive, supportive, fun yet challenging team environment. We value having a team that is made up of diverse set of backgrounds and respect the healthy expression of diverse opinions. We deliver on the promise of innovation. Come join us as we continue to change the world of insurance market with our technology. We have an exciting career path available to our team members; we deliver solutions on a range of cutting-edge technologies, and we love to developer people internally in giving them opportunities to learn those technologies.